The WRFN Election Appeal Board was officially appointed on December 19, 2025, and the first meeting of the board occurred on January 4, 2026.
The Elders’ Caucus received five (5) Notices of Appeal regarding the results of the most recent election for Chief and Council. The Elders’ Caucus subsequently determined that each of the Notices of Appeal met the requirements set out in section 9.7 of the Election Code and on November 14, 2025, posted an Expression of Interest for Candidates who wished to sit on the Appeal Board that will consider and decide each of the Notices of Appeal.
Members of the Appeal Board are Rose-Marie Blair-Isberg, Hayden McHugh, and Jessica Lott Thompson.

NOTICES OF APPEAL RECEIVED – January 7, 2026
The Appeal Board received copies of five (5) Notices of Appeal from the Elders’ Caucus for review, investigation and decision under Article 9 of the Election Code.
LETTERS REQUESTING FORMAL RESPONSE SENT OUT – January 9, 2026
The Appeal Board sent the Notices of Appeal to the Election Officer and candidates requesting their formal Response by January 20, 2026 (10 days).
INVESTIGATION STAGE STARTS – January 13, 2026
The Appeal Board has begun its investigation stage. On January 13, letters were sent providing a detailed update to all individuals who have filed Notices of Appeal. We will also be sending letters to other individuals requesting evidence or information as required. The Appeal Board investigation stage will conclude ten (10) days after we receive the Responses to the Notices of Appeal. At this time, the Appeal Board expects to conclude our investigation stage by late January 2026.

PUBLIC NOTICE – ELECTION APPEAL BOARD
TAKE NOTICE that the White River First Nation (“WRFN”) Election Appeal Board wishes to provide an update to the WRFN community regarding next steps in the appeal process as set out in the WRFN Custom Election Code (“Election Code”).
APPOINTMENT
The Appeal Board was duly appointed on December 19, 2025, by the Elders’ Caucus according to Art. 9.9-9.12 of the Election Code to investigate and decide on election appeals.
TIMELINE AND PROCESS STEPS
The first official meeting of the Appeal Board was held on January 4, 2026. The Appeal Board received copies of five (5) Notices of Appeal from the Elders’ Caucus on January 7, 2026. Following the procedure and requirements of Art.9 of the Election Code, on January 9, 2026, the Appeal Board then sent copies of all five (5) Notices of Appeal to the Election Officer and candidates in the 2025 election. The Appeal Board, following the process set out in Art.9 of the Election Code has provided a ten (10) day deadline of January 20, 2026, for the Appeal Board to receive any formal Responses from candidates and/or the Election Officer.
INVESTIGATION STAGE
The Appeal Board has now begun its investigation stage as required by the process set out in the Election Code. As part of its investigation stage, the Appeal Board will also be sending additional written requests for further information and clarification to various parties in the coming days.
The Appeal Board’s investigation stage will conclude ten (10) days after all formal Responses to the Notices of Appeal are received from the Election Officer and candidates. Once the investigation stage is over, the Appeal Board will issue a written decision on the five (5) Notices of Appeal as soon as possible.

INVESTIGATION STAGE NOW COMPLETE – February 10, 2026
The Appeal Board has now completed its investigation stage as of February 10, 2026.
The initial deadline for responses to the Notices of Appeal from candidates and the Election Officer was January 20, 2026. Extensions were requested and granted for late submission of responses up to January 31, 2026. The Appeal Board also conducted a witness interview on February 4, 2026, and concluded its investigation stage on February 10, 2026.
According to the Election Code, the Appeal Board's investigation stage ends ten (10) days after we receive the Responses to the Notices of Appeal.

APPEAL BOARD SEEKS CONSENT TO JOIN NOTICES OF APPEAL – February 25, 2026
On February 20, 2026, the Appeal Board contacted the Appellants for each of the five (5) Notices of Appeal to request their consent to join their Appeals together for the purpose of issuing one joint decision that would address all of the issues together.
We are actively working on communicating with each of the Appellants as soon as possible. As of today, February 25, 2026, the Appeal Board has not heard back from all Appellants. Thank you to those who have already contacted us to provide your response.
Once this question is resolved, the Appeal Board will issue its decision as soon as possible.

APPEAL BOARD PUBLISHES JOINT DECISION – February 27, 2026
On February 27, 2026, the Appeal Board has published its joint decision regarding the five (5) Notices of Appeal regarding the 2025 WRFN Election.
All of the Appellants consented in writing for the Appeal Board to issue one joint decision that would address all of the issues together.
